Before getting married, I knew my husband's family was not well off, but after we got married, the truth behind it shocked me.


*This is a woman's shared article posted on Toutiao.

My husband and I were university classmates. Coming from the countryside, I was very diligent in my studies and work. I was always the top student, actively participated in school activities, and knew how to dress. My family was also well-off, my parents provided for me every month and I used my monthly salary to buy clothes.

Biết bạn trai nghèo không chê, sau cưới bố mẹ cho mua nhà: Làm thủ tục để chồng đứng tên xong lại quyết định ly hôn - Ảnh 1.

In college, I was also a popular figure. There were many people pursuing me, but the one I liked the most was my husband. As soon as I saw him, I knew he was the one I could grow old with.

During our relationship, my husband did not do anything too romantic, nor did he spend much money on me. On the contrary, there were times when I had to lend him my savings. The reason I married him was because he was a warm and caring person, and I felt safe when I was with him.

When I graduated from university, he proposed to me and of course I said yes. Half a year later we got married. Before the wedding, my parents visited his family. His family lived in a rather old house. His parents were both workers. My parents understood, sympathized and still agreed to let me marry him.

After my husband and I got married, my mother-in-law said that renting a house was not a good idea, so she gave us some money to buy an apartment to live in.

When I went to buy a house, because I did not have a household registration in the city, I asked my husband to buy the house in his name. But he kept refusing, hesitating and not saying anything. The staff standing next to me urged me, so I gave my husband's ID card to the staff so he could check and proceed with the procedure. Unexpectedly, he said my husband had an apartment. Moreover, in addition to the house where my parents-in-law were staying, my husband's family also had another house, in my mother-in-law's name. It turned out that my "poor" husband had 3 houses.

Biết bạn trai nghèo không chê, sau cưới bố mẹ cho mua nhà: Làm thủ tục để chồng đứng tên xong lại quyết định ly hôn - Ảnh 2.

I just asked my husband about this, he said that my in-laws wanted to test me. They waited until I gave birth to a child before telling me the truth, but I didn’t expect this matter to be discovered so soon. After hearing my husband’s words, I really wanted a divorce.
